About me

Rebecca has over 13 years’ qualified experience working with individuals with diverse physical, mental health and personality difficulties in a variety of clinical and research contexts. Within the NHS, she previously worked as the Lead Clinical Psychologist and ran the therapy service at a high secure female prison within the Offender Care CNWL NHS Foundation Trust. She also provides training and supports NHS staff teams working in highly pressured environments and supervises psychologists. Currently she is a Consultant Clinical Psychologist working in the addictions service for CNWL NHS Trust.

Rebecca specialises in the provision of evidence-based psychological therapies for individuals experiencing a wide range of emotional difficulties such as relationship and personality problems; low-self-esteem; depression; anxiety; emotional regulation problems; trauma; and psychotic experiences. She specialises in providing Cognitive Behaviour Therapy and related approaches; Dialectical Behaviour Therapy, Acceptance and Commitment Therapy, Compassion Focused Therapy and Mindfulness-based approaches, as well as drawing from Psychodynamic, Systemic and Narrative therapy techniques. She is also trained in Eye Movement and De-sensitisation Reprocessing.

She has published extensively and presented at national and international conferences on the topics of working with Personality Disorders, managing self-harm and suicide and eating disorders.
